Transaction 870f77eaae18d803088267985c12bd029a05fa6a3be896bd2d3003636e37620a

1 Input
2 Outputs
  • 870f77eaae18d803088267985c12bd029a05fa6a3be896bd2d3003636e37620a:0
  • value  47518600
    address  15XKGsVmh4rtTCcUMErttLbLBV1tuqw41n
  • 870f77eaae18d803088267985c12bd029a05fa6a3be896bd2d3003636e37620a:1
  • value  33915543
    address  3GHuBGkDp9kotraEBnqkhaNcfqtBjW186B